Alternatively I can get access to the previous harddrive, but it has been formatted. Is there a signature-based deep scanner available to detect wallet files?
You *might* be able to use Pywallet to scan the formatted drive looking for wallets and or keys. It has a
--recover mode that scans the drive. Might take a while depending on drive size.
It works with Bitcoin... And I believe you can use the
--otherversion parameter to make it look for litecoin... Not sure if it works for zcash
